Salary Range & Percentiles
Pay distribution across experience levels
10th Percentile — Entry Level$28,646
25th Percentile — Junior$34,502
50th Percentile — Median$36,942
75th Percentile — Senior$47,678
90th Percentile — Top Earners$51,945
